Abstract
This paper explores the potential of integrating Confucian principles such as respect, communal harmony and moral development into the design of contemporary educational spaces. It examines how traditional Chinese cultural values can coexist with contemporary educational needs by focusing on key elements such as spatial hierarchy, axial symmetry, and communal space. Using Qufu, China, as a case study, this paper highlights the challenges of globalization in preserving cultural identity and proposes a theoretical foundation for future design frameworks. The findings lay a foundation for future research, advocating for educational spaces that embody cultural heritage while meeting contemporary needs.
